Moorfields" Mutual Improvement Society, Welsh Baptist Chapel, Little Alie St., Aldgate, 15. /J,r- r, r-r-r- r.r- r, 'r-r.f,r-J' 11 COMPETITIVE CONCERT will be held at the above place on TUESDAY EVENING, JANUARY 21. 1908. Chairman GWILYM HINDS, Esq. Adjudicators— Music J. B. SACKVILLE E VANS, Eq. .Recitation Rev. J. MACHRETH HEEb. Accompanist-Miss DEBORAH REES, R.U.M. Subjects-Music Soprano, Blodau'r Haf (Caradosj Jones). Contralto," Bryniau Aurfy Ngwlad" (T. V. Davies). Tenor," Llwybr y Wyddfa" (W. Davies). Bass, Pererin (W. Davies). Prize 21 Is. Recita- tion, Araith Llewelyn (Elfed). Prize 10s. 6d. Conditions-(l) The Adjudicators can divide or with- hold prizes according to merit. (2) Competitions open to all comers. (3) Names (Noms de plume) of intending Competitors to reach the Secretary not later than January 14th. Doors open 7 p.m. To commence 7.30. ADMISSION, ONE SHILLING. Secretary, I. JONES, 1, Clift Street, New North Rd., N. NOTE.-Advertisements must reach the Office by Wednesday morning for insertion in the current week's number.
